The Golden Boot and Beyond: Kane's 2018 World Cup Heroics

Let's rewind to the 2018 FIFA World Cup in Russia, shall we? This is where Harry Kane truly announced himself on the global stage as a world-class striker, and his World Cup goals started to rack up impressively. He didn't just score; he dominated, finishing as the tournament's top scorer and winning the coveted Golden Boot. This was a massive achievement, especially for an English player, and it cemented his status as one of the best strikers on the planet. His campaign kicked off with a bang against Tunisia, where he netted a late winner to secure three points for England. But it was the match against Panama that truly showcased his predatory instincts. Kane bagged a hat-trick in a dominant 6-1 victory, demonstrating his versatility and clinical finishing. He scored with his head, a penalty, and a deflected shot, showing he can score in multiple ways. The Penalty King: Kane's Continued World Cup Impact in 2022

Moving on to the 2022 FIFA World Cup in Qatar, Harry Kane continued to add to his World Cup goals tally, further solidifying his place in England's history books. While the team's journey ended in the quarter-finals, Kane's individual performance, especially from the penalty spot, was once again a highlight. He proved that even under new pressures and in different conditions, his knack for scoring remains intact. His opening goal against Senegal in the Round of 16 was a crucial moment, a calm and composed finish that put England ahead and demonstrated his clinical ability when it matters most. This goal also saw him overtake Sir Bobby Charlton to become England's second-highest all-time goalscorer, a truly monumental achievement. Later in the tournament, against France in the quarter-finals, he scored a dramatic penalty to equalize for England. This goal was particularly significant as it brought him level with Wayne Rooney as England's all-time top scorer.
